Karnataka Deputy Chief Minister and KPCC President DK Shivakumar has urged women not to form organisations along caste lines, but to build inclusive platforms that represent all women.

Addressing a conference of women government employees at the Banquet Hall in Vidhana Soudha on Thursday, Shivakumar said, “Under no condition should you give in and break your organisation on caste lines. It should be for all women. You should have one women’s employees’ organisation — that is my advice.”

Recalling his long association with government employees’ bodies, he said, “I have been observing these organisations since the days of Bangarappa.
